The 2012 Financial Performance Analysis reveals a remarkable growth trajectory characterized by enhanced profitability and an increasing number of customers. Notably, the growth in borrowing customer base significantly contributes to asset expansion and overall financial health. The organization boasts a well-diversified asset portfolio with consistent improvements in asset quality. Continued investment in technology and a strong capital base supports operational efficiency. Prudent financial strategies and renewed focus on shareholder value underscore the commitment to sustainable growth and enhanced returns on investment.
